Key Insights of Japan Blood Volume Analyzer Market

  •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ately $150 million, reflecting steady adoption driven by aging demographics and rising chronic disease prevalence.
  • Forecast Value (2026): Projected to reach around $210 million, with a CAGR of 12% over 2023–2030, driven by technological innovation and healthcare digitization.
  • Leading Segment: Automated blood volume analyzers dominate, accounting for over 65% of sales, favored for their accuracy and integration capabilities.
  • Core Application: Hematology diagnostics and volume assessment remain primary use cases, especially in cardiology and nephrology clinics.
  • Leading Geography: Tokyo metropolitan area holds over 40% market share, benefiting from advanced healthcare infrastructure and higher healthcare expenditure.
  • Key Market Opportunity: Growing demand for portable, AI-enabled analyzers presents a significant growth avenue, especially in outpatient and primary care settings.
  • Major Companies: Major players include Sysmex Corporation, Beckman Coulter, and Nihon Kohden, competing on innovation and service networks.

Market Dynamics and Industry Evolution in Japan’s Blood Volume Analyzer Sector

The Japan blood volume analyzer market is currently positioned at a growth juncture characterized by technological innovation, demographic shifts, and regulatory reforms. The sector has transitioned from traditional manual systems to sophisticated automated and AI-powered devices, driven by the need for rapid, accurate diagnostics amid an aging population with complex health needs. This evolution is supported by Japan’s robust healthcare infrastructure, government initiatives promoting digital health, and increasing investments in medical device R&D.

Market maturity varies across regions, with metropolitan areas leading adoption due to higher healthcare spending and advanced clinical practices. The sector’s growth is also influenced by the rising prevalence of cardiovascular, renal, and hematological disorders, which necessitate precise blood volume measurements. Strategic collaborations between device manufacturers and healthcare providers are accelerating innovation, while regulatory pathways are becoming more streamlined, fostering faster product launches. Despite these positives, challenges such as high device costs, reimbursement complexities, and technological integration hurdles persist, requiring strategic navigation by market players.

Japan Blood Volume Analyzer Market: Regulatory Environment and Policy Impact

The regulatory landscape in Japan significantly influences market dynamics, with the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are (MHLW) setting stringent standards for medical device approval and safety. Recent reforms aim to accelerate approval processes for innovative diagnostic tools, including AI-enabled analyzers, fostering a more dynamic market environment. Reimbursement policies are evolving to better support advanced diagnostics, although complexities remain, impacting device pricing and adoption rates.

Government initiatives promoting digital health, telemedicine, and AI integration are creating favorable conditions for market expansion. Additionally, policies targeting aging populations and chronic disease management are incentivizing healthcare providers to adopt more efficient blood volume assessment tools. Navigating this regulatory environment requires strategic compliance, proactive engagement with policymakers, and continuous adaptation to policy shifts, which are critical for sustained market growth.
